Noted city doctor Andreas Dkhar passes away

SHILLONG, May 27: Additional DHS and Medical Superintendent of Shillong Civil Hospital, Dr Andreas Dkhar passed away at Super Care Hospital on Saturday at around 7.30 am.
He was 57.
Dkhar had suffered a massive stroke on Wednesday night at his residence. His body was shifted to his residence at Pohkseh here.
His funeral will be held at the Catholic Church Cemetery situated at Nongshiliang, Nongthymmai, at 2 pm on Monday.
Meanwhile, the office of the Joint Director of Health Services, Civil Hospital has informed that as a token of respect and appreciation of his contribution towards healthcare sector, the OPD will remain open till 12 noon on Monday but emergency services will continue.
